Output cb134c004946cb24cadf091adb7e42bcc1339134ea4c2348795ca494356417bd:60

value
1461500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7c95e64962d19bcbdb4cb7189b214672caad6f25 OP_EQUAL
address
3D3mHXxW4J2u57941Poi6G8Ejtpp6vkir6
transaction
cb134c004946cb24cadf091adb7e42bcc1339134ea4c2348795ca494356417bd
confirmations
308581
spent
true